Q&A

回答の並べ替え:
投稿新規に質問を投稿する

CELFでリモート接続してPCを操作する場合

knrm knrm

2020-12-08 11:55

CELFで別のサーバへリモート接続し、そのサーバ内で操作をおこなうロボットを作成しています。

リモート接続が可能なところまでは確認できたのですが、接続先のサーバ内での操作を実装する場合、画面認識やマウス操作のみで処理を実装するしか無いでしょうか?

例えば、「アプリケーションを起動する」を使用しましたが、おそらく参照しているのは接続元のPCで、接続元PCには対象のアプリケーションが無いので「ファイルが見つかりません」のエラーとなります。

CELFでリモート接続しても、実装できるのはリモートの画面に対する操作のみで、あくまでもデータの参照先などは接続元(自PC)という認識ですが合っていますか?

knrm knrm
rokusanyon さん、ご回答ありがとうございました。

リモート接続先での操作の実装の件、分かりました。
キーボード操作を優先として作成を進めてみたいと思います。

また、データ参照先についても分かりました。
rokusanyon rokusanyon
画面認識やマウス操作のみで処理を実装する場合、
ロボットアクションで画像を取得したPCと実際に動作させるPCが
違うと、画像の解像度が違う等で正常に動作しない可能性があります。
(キータイプアクションなら大丈夫かもしれません)

https://cloud.celf.jp/celf-rpa-help/ja/texts/notes/index.html#id3

接続元(自PC)でCELFを起動している場合は、データの参照先などは
接続元(自PC)になるとおもいます。